What is KyUMH?
Founded in 1871, KyUMH operates as a critical non-profit agency affiliated with the Kentucky United Methodist Church. The organization provides essential residential and community-based support systems for children and families navigating the complexities of abuse, neglect, and trauma. With dual campuses in Nicholasville and Owensboro, the agency maintains a robust market position as a primary provider of trauma-informed care, bridging the gap between institutional support and community-based rehabilitation services.
